A leading healthcare charity in Guildford is seeking a Scrub Practitioner/ Theatre Practitioner (ODP) to join their team. The role requires registration with NMC or HCPC and post-registration experience.
Responsibilities include:
- Providing high-quality perioperative care
- Working within a multidisciplinary team
- Supporting junior professionals
